Heart Disease - Mark 3:1-6

Mark 3:1 He entered again into a synagogue; and a man was there whose hand was withered. 2 They were watching Him to see if He would heal him on the Sabbath, so that they might accuse Him. 3 He said to the man with the withered hand, "Get up and come forward!" 4 And He said to them, "Is it lawful to do good or to do harm on the Sabbath, to save a life or to kill?" But they kept silent. 5 After looking around at them with anger, grieved at their hardness of heart, He said to the man, "Stretch out your hand." And he stretched it out, and his hand was restored. 6 The Pharisees went out and immediately began conspiring with the Herodians against Him, as to how they might destroy Him. Sermon built from notes taken of a sermon delivered by Rod Farthing at Madisonville. KY circa 1990

Introduction: (all scripture quotations are from the New American Standard Bible unless otherwise indicated)

1. Sclerosis -- The thickening or hardening of a tissue or part -- Great Encyclopedic Dictionary 1968

2. Arteriosclerosis - The thickening and hardening of the inner walls of an artery with an impairment of blood circulation, as in old age. -- Great Encyclopedic Dictionary 1968

3. Sklerokardian -- Cardiosklerosis -- Hardness of the heart -- The thickening and hardening of the inner walls of our spirit that causes an impairment of feelings and compassion for others, as in self righteous, selfish, and spiritually atrophied.

4. This event in the ministry of Jesus illustrates how religious people can forget to practice the two greatest commandments.

I. The Cause of Cardiosklerosis (A Hardened Heart)- 2 "They were watching Him to see if He would heal him on the Sabbath, so that they might accuse Him."

1. People have hardened hearts when they are more interested in personal position than the needs of other people.

2. People have hardened hearts when they are more interested in protecting personal power than the needs of people around us.

3. People have hardened hearts when they are more interested in maintaining the status quo than the challenges of social, spiritual and economic outreach to people in need.

4. Passive apathy of Christians is greater danger to our way of life than the aggressive violence of a minority or the loud voices of the secular media.

II. The Complications of Cardiosklerosis (A Hardened Heart) 3, 4, 6 He said to the man with the withered hand, "Get up and come forward!" 4 And He said to them, "Is it lawful to do good or to do harm on the Sabbath, to save a life or to kill?" But they kept silent..... 6 The Pharisees went out and immediately began conspiring with the Herodians against Him, as to how they might destroy Him.

1. People add complications to hardened hearts when they remain ignorant even with need staring them in the face. - 3

Reporter once asked a politician: Senator, Do you think that our nation is in trouble because of ignorance and indifference? His answer: I don't know and I don't care.

"The greatest danger to the church is prejudice and indifference and ignorance is the mother of them both." Glenn Bourne circa 1966 in Building a Missionary Church Class at St. Louis Christian College.

2. People add complications to hardened hearts when they refuse to accept the truth even when it is revealed to them - 4

3. People add complications to hardened hearts when they let their own feeling dictate what they will do rather than His Truth. - 6

III. The Cure of Cardiosklerosis (A Hardened Heart) -5 After looking around at them with anger, grieved at their hardness of heart, He said to the man, "Stretch out your hand." And he stretched it out, and his hand was restored.

1. One of the things that angers Jesus is people who have no compassion for others and are more interested in what religion does for themselves than it affects even God or His kingdom.

2. Jesus cared enough about people to meet their needs in spite of what the consequences might be for Him personally.
